The Islamic State has claimed responsibility for a deadly blast at a Shia mosque in Islamabad, which resulted in over three dozen casualties. The terror outfit’s mouthpiece stated the attack was a Fidayeen operation by a soldier of the Islamic State in Pakistan Province. This claim comes amidst growing sectarian tensions and an IS call for Lashkar-e-Taiba members to defect.
